市场概述

全球短链果寡糖(scFOS)市场规模在2022年达到5.705亿美元,预计到2030年将达到12.318亿美元。在2023-2030年的预测期内,该市场的复合年增长率为10.1%。

随着人们越来越认识到肠道微生物群在整体健康中的作用,消化健康已成为消费者关注的重点领域。ScFOS作为益生元,可滋养和促进肠道有益菌的生长,支持健康的肠道微生物群组成。ScFOS可作为益生菌(促进肠道健康的有益菌)的营养来源。

在产品中将ScFOS与益生菌结合使用,可通过支持益生菌菌株的存活和生长而提供协同效益。ScFOS可作为功能性配料应用于各种食品和饮料产品中。ScFOS可被添加到各种配方中,包括乳制品、烘焙食品、谷物、饮料和营养补充剂,以增强其营养成分并提供额外的健康益处。

市场动态

消费者对消化健康的日益关注将促进短链果寡糖市场的增长

科学研究揭示了肠道微生物群在维持消化系统健康和整体健康中的关键作用。肠道细菌的组成和多样性影响人体健康的各个方面,包括消化、免疫功能和心理健康。作为一种益生元成分,scFOS可选择性地促进肠道有益菌的生长,从而对肠道微生物群的组成产生积极影响,并有助于消化系统的健康。根据美国国家医学图书馆(National Library of Medicine)的研究,在摄入2.5和5克/天剂量的scFOS时,腹胀会明显加剧,但在摄入7.5和10克/天剂量时,腹胀不会加剧。

功能性食品和饮料需求的增加有望推动短链果寡糖市场的发展

肠易激综合征(IBS)和炎症性肠病(IBD)等消化系统疾病在全球越来越普遍。因此,人们对有助于控制这些疾病和促进消化系统健康的食品和饮料产品的需求日益增长。具有益生元特性的ScFOS提供了一种天然的解决方案,有可能缓解症状并改善肠道功能。近年来,肠道健康在整体健康中的重要性得到了广泛关注。消费者越来越意识到健康的肠道微生物群与各方面健康之间的联系,包括消化、免疫功能甚至心理健康。

Market Overview

The Global Short-Chain Fructooligosaccharides (scFOS) market reached US$ 570.5 million in 2022 and is projected to witness lucrative growth by reaching up to US$ 1,231.8 million by 2030. The market is growing at a CAGR of 10.1% during the forecast period 2023-2030.

Digestive health has become a key area of focus for consumers, with increasing recognition of the role of gut microbiota in overall wellness. ScFOS, as prebiotics, nourish and promote the growth of beneficial gut bacteria, supporting a healthy gut microbiota composition. ScFOS can act as a source of nutrients for probiotics, the beneficial bacteria that promote gut health.

Combining scFOS with probiotics in products can provide synergistic benefits by supporting the survival and growth of probiotic strains. ScFOS find applications as functional ingredients in various food and beverage products. They can be incorporated into a wide range of formulations, including dairy products, baked goods, cereals, beverages, and nutritional supplements, to enhance their nutritional profile and provide additional health benefits.

Market Dynamics

Increasing Consumers Focus on Digestive Health is Anticipated to Grow the Short-Chain Fructooligosaccharides Market's Growth

Scientific research has uncovered the critical role of gut microbiota in maintaining digestive health and overall well-being. The composition and diversity of gut bacteria influence various aspects of human health, including digestion, immune function, and mental health. As a prebiotic ingredient, scFOS selectively promotes the growth of beneficial gut bacteria, which can positively impact the gut microbiota composition and contribute to digestive health. According to the National Library of Medicine, Bloating was significantly more intense during scFOS ingestion at doses of 2.5 and 5 g/d, but not at doses of 7.5 and 10 g/d.

Increasing Demand for Functional Foods and Beverages is Expected to Fuel the Short-Chain Fructooligosaccharides Market

Digestive disorders such as ir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) and inflammatory bowel disease (IBD) are becoming more prevalent globally. As a result, there is a growing demand for food and beverage products that can help manage these conditions and promote digestive wellness. ScFOS, with its prebiotic properties, offers a natural solution that can potentially alleviate symptoms and improve gut function. The importance of gut health in overall wellness has gained significant attention in recent years. Consumers are becoming more aware of the link between a healthy gut microbiome and various aspects of health, including digestion, immune function, and even mental well-being.

Segment Analysis

The global short-chain fructooligosaccharides market is segmented based on source, form, application, and region.

By Application, the Food & Beverages Segment Accounted for the Highest Share of the Global Short-Chain Fructooligosaccharides Market

Short-chain fructooligosaccharides (scFOS) find extensive applications in the food and beverages industry. They are used as functional ingredients in various products, including dairy products, baked goods, cereals, beverages, and nutritional supplements. The versatility of scFOS and their compatibility with different food matrices make them popular among food and beverage manufacturers.

There is a growing consumer demand for functional foods and beverages that offer additional health benefits beyond basic nutrition. Functional ingredients like scFOS, known for their prebiotic properties and potential health benefits, are highly sought after by health-conscious consumers. The food and beverages segment responds to this demand by incorporating scFOS into its product formulations.
